SIMPLE AND EASY FIX! Thanks a million, Chris! I watched your video and must've had #2, a blocked or frozen flow tube (freezer was set to 7/7; coldest setting)? I let freezer thaw for just over a half hour with the freezer door open; Ice cube blessings were in the works: the cog then turned and did a full rotation (versus stuck and grinding noise), something clicked, old cubes were spit out, the arm then raised and water turned on and off to fill the "tray." Hallelujah and thank you!! God bless you for having taken the time to share your knowledge with the world. Grateful in WY, ff
PS I now have freezer set to average coolness.

This is a rock solid tutorial and the way this man speaks is fully understandable and it absorbs well.
I did flood my freezer and shocked myself but we will see if we have ice cubes in a couple of hours.



If you don't want to shock yourself, then unplug the freezer. If you want a tickle, at least keep 1 hand in your pocket.
If you don't want to flood your freezer, do not adjust water pressure as your first order of measure. Water pressure also means "Water Level". turning that up will cause the ice maker to over flow. Ask me how I know.
